Trims, Features & Pricing

Choose Your Specification

Premium

$60,000

Best for Value Seekers

The Q7 Premium delivers excellent luxury at the most approachable price point. Its 2.0L turbo engine provides smooth, efficient performance ideal for daily commuting, while Quattro AWD ensures confidence in all weather. Standard features include heated leather seats, a dual-touchscreen MMI system, tri-zone climate control, and a panoramic sunroof. Safety tech includes lane departure warning, front/rear sensors, and forward collision assist. This trim is perfect for buyers who want Audi refinement without stepping deep into premium pricing. It covers all essentials with a quiet ride, dependable performance, and a well-crafted cabin that feels luxurious for the money.

Our Recommendation

Premium Plus

$63,000

Best for Most Buyers

Premium Plus elevates the Q7 with meaningful upgrades that enhance convenience, technology, and comfort. It offers the same engine choices but adds a premium Bang & Olufsen sound system, wireless phone charging, a 360° camera, and adaptive cruise with lane guidance. The cabin benefits from improved lighting, better materials, and additional driver-assist features. Buyers can also upgrade to the V6 for improved power and towing capability. Overall, Premium Plus is the smartest choice for balancing price, luxury, and features. It gives families the enhanced tech and comfort they truly feel every day without reaching Prestige-level pricing.

Prestige

$73,000

Best for Luxury Shoppers

The Prestige trim represents the highest expression of Q7 luxury, with Audi’s advanced Matrix-design LED headlights, a head-up display, extended leather packages, and soft-close doors. The standard V6 engine delivers smooth, confident acceleration that suits highway driving and family travel. Comfort enhancements include four-zone climate control, ventilated seats, and advanced adaptive air suspension for an exceptionally quiet ride. Additional driver aids bring near-seamless highway assistance and superior visibility. This trim is tailored for buyers who want the Q7 at its most sophisticated, combining top-tier comfort, premium materials, and advanced features to create a truly upscale travel experience.

Car Specifications

Trim by Trim

Select your car trims and compare them instantly

SpecificationPremiumPremium PlusPrestige
Engine2.0L Turbo I42.0L Turbo I4 or 3.0L V63.0L Turbo V6
Horsepower261 hp261–335 hp335 hp
MPG (City/Hwy)20 / 2618 / 2618 / 24
Seating777
Cargo Capacity14.2–69.6 cu ft14.2–69.6 cu ft14.2–69.6 cu ft
DrivetrainAWDAWDAWD
Transmission8-speed automatic8-speed automatic8-speed automatic
MSRP (Starting)$60,000$63,000$73,000
Car TypeLuxury 3-row SUVLuxury 3-row SUVLuxury 3-row SUV
What It Costs to Drive

The Cost of Ownership

The 2025 Audi Q7’s annual ownership costs:

Avg. Yearly Cost
$4,400–$5,600Yearly$365–$465Monthly
Fuel
$2,100–$2,500Yearly$175–$210Monthly
Insurance
$1,700–$2,200Yearly$140–$185Monthly
Maintenance
$600–$900Yearly$50–$75Monthly

Assumptions: Based on average U.S. driver (12,000 miles/year, fuel price ~$3.75/gal, good driving record).

Exterior

4.5

Elegant, modern, and confidently upscale.

The 2025 Q7 delivers a commanding presence with its large Singleframe grille, clean LED lighting, and athletic proportions despite its size. The lines are crisp yet understated, giving it a timeless luxury appeal rather than aggressive styling. New wheel designs and appearance packages offer attractive customization choices, while the overall build quality feels solid and meticulously engineered.

Interior

4.5

Luxurious, quiet, and intuitively designed.

Inside the Q7, passengers are treated to a premium cabin filled with high-quality materials, thoughtful ergonomics, and a refined sense of craftsmanship. The seats are supportive with excellent adjustability, and the second row is spacious enough for adults. While the third row is tighter, it works well for kids and short trips. Dual touchscreens offer crisp graphics and easy navigation.

Safety

5

Robust safety suite with top-tier features.

Audi equips the Q7 with an impressive set of standard and available safety technologies. Adaptive cruise control, lane-keeping assist, blind-spot monitoring, and intersection assist provide a secure driving experience. Available 360° camera upgrades visibility, and the Q7 historically performs very well in crash tests. Families will appreciate Audi’s consistent focus on structural safety and advanced driver support.

Warranty

4

Competitive luxury warranty with strong coverage.

Audi offers 4 years/50,000 miles of bumper-to-bumper coverage and 4 years of roadside assistance. While not as long as some mainstream brands, it aligns with luxury-class standards. Audi’s reliability improvements in recent years make ownership more predictable, and the warranty covers the many advanced tech components packed into the Q7.

Fuel Economy

3.5

Respectable for its size but not class-leading.

With EPA ratings in the low-to-mid 20s, the Q7 performs as expected for a large luxury SUV. The four-cylinder offers the best economy, while the V6 trades efficiency for stronger acceleration and more capability. Real-world numbers often land slightly below EPA estimates, especially with full passenger loads or frequent highway driving.

Tech & Infotainment

4.5

Feature-rich, polished, and intuitive.

Audi’s MMI system remains one of the most user-friendly in luxury SUVs. The dual-touchscreen setup offers fast responses, sharp visuals, and simple menu structures. Wireless smartphone integration, premium audio, and available AR-style navigation create a modern, connected experience. Tech lovers will appreciate how seamlessly the Q7 blends innovation with ease of use.

Performance & Handling

4

Smooth, controlled, and confident across all conditions.

The Q7 shines with a refined driving experience rather than outright performance. The 2.0L turbo feels adequate for commuting, while the V6 offers smooth and authoritative power for highway passing and towing. The suspension delivers a quiet, composed ride, especially with the optional adaptive air setup. Steering is precise, making this large SUV surprisingly easy to maneuver.

Questions

Asked & Answered

Is the 2025 Audi Q7 good for families?

Yes — it offers excellent comfort, advanced safety tech, and strong everyday usability, though the third row suits children best.

Does the Q7 require premium fuel?

Yes, Audi recommends premium gasoline for optimal performance and efficiency.

Which engine is best for most buyers?

The V6 offers the best balance of performance and capability, especially for highway driving or towing.

How much can the Q7 tow?

Properly equipped, the Q7 can tow up to 7,700 lbs with the V6 engine.

Is the Q7 expensive to maintain?

Maintenance is higher than mainstream SUVs but competitive with luxury rivals, especially with Audi’s improved reliability.

Does the Q7 offer true off-road capability?

Quattro AWD provides excellent traction, but the Q7 is tuned more for road comfort than rugged trail driving.
